SECTION 5 – CORPORATE GOVERNANCE AND MANAGEMENT
Item 5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ders
(a)NextEra Energy, Inc. (NEE) held a special meeting of shareholders (2026 Special Meeting) on September 3, 2026, in connection with its previously announced pending merger with Dominion Energy, Inc. (Dominion Energy). As of the close of business on July 24, 2026, the record date for the 2026 Special Meeting, there were 2,085,978,209 shares of NEE common stock, par value $0.01 per share (NEE common stock), issued and outstanding. A total of 1,625,030,947 shares of NEE common stock were represented in person or by proxy at the 2026 Special Meeting, which constituted a quorum to conduct business at the meeting. At the 2026 Special Meeting, NEE’s shareholders approved three management proposals. The proposals are described in detail in the joint proxy statement/prospectus (Joint Proxy Statement), fil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ission on July 28, 2026.
(b)The final voting results with respect to each proposal voted upon at the 2026 Special Meeting are set forth below.
Proposal 1
NEE's shareholders approved, as set forth below, the issuance of shares of NEE common stock to shareholders of Dominion Energy in the first merger, pursuant to the terms of the Agreement and Plan of Merger, dated as of May 15, 2026, by and among NEE, Dominion Energy, WG Development Corp., a Virginia corporation and direct wholly owned subsidiary of NEE, and CS Holdco, LLC, a Virginia limited liability company and direct wholly owned subsidiary of NEE (as that agreement may be amended from time to time, the “merger agreement”), and the first plan of merger:
| FOR | % VOTES CAST FOR | AGAINST | ABSTENTIONS | BROKER NON-VOTES | |||||||||||||||||||||||||
| 1,612,635,616 | 99.47% | 8,545,037 | 3,850,294 | — | |||||||||||||||||||||||||
Proposal 2
NEE's shareholders approved, as set forth below, an amendment to NEE’s articles of incorporation to increase the number of authorized shares of NEE common stock from 3,200,000,000 shares to 5,000,000,000 shares, as described in the Joint Proxy Statement and as reflected in the form of Articles of Amendment to Second Restated Articles of Incorporation of NEE:
| FOR | % VOTES CAST FOR | AGAINST | ABSTENTIONS | BROKER NON-VOTES | ||||||||||||||||||||||
| 1,606,841,941 | 99.02% | 15,832,955 | 2,356,051 | — | ||||||||||||||||||||||
Proposal 3
NEE's shareholders approved, as set forth below, the proposal to adjourn the 2026 Special Meeting to a later date or time, if necessary or appropriate, (i) if there are not sufficient votes at the time of the 2026 Special Meeting to approve the NEE share issuance proposal in order to solicit additional proxies, (ii) as required by law or (iii) in the event that Dominion Energy postpones the Dominion Energy special meeting pursuant to the terms of the merger agreement, NEE shall, upon the reasonable request of Dominion Energy, postpone or adjourn the 2026 Special Meeting once for up to 30 days so that the special meetings may occur on the same calendar day:
| FOR | % VOTES CAST FOR | AGAINST | ABSTENTIONS | BROKER NON-VOTES | ||||||||||||||||||||||
| 1,498,123,156 | 92.33% | 124,314,270 | 2,593,521 | — | ||||||||||||||||||||||
